  1. Ravine Flats at Iuka
    5.0(5 reviews)FMP Score

    why it ranked: Ravine Flats at Iuka stands out as the top overall choice near OSU because it combines a genuinely peaceful location with the kind of management that actually cares about your experience. Residents rave about the recent renovations, free washer and dryers, and the lightning-fast response times when anything needs fixing. What really sets this place apart is the team in the leasing office especially Ally, who goes way beyond the job description: as one resident put it, she "triples as a leasing manager, friend, and mentor to many of the tenants." You'll feel at home here from day one.

  2. Wilson Place
    4.2(5 reviews)FMP Score

    why it ranked: Wilson Place earns its ranking with a prime location close to campus and modern amenities like a gym and well-maintained shared spaces that make student life easier. The building itself is clean and spacious, and when management is on their game, residents feel genuinely safe and supported. That said, experiences here vary some students praise the friendly, responsive team, while others have found the property inconsistent with what's advertised and slow on maintenance. As one satisfied resident noted, "The location is perfect, close to campus and convenient for daily life," though you'll want to document everything in writing to protect yourself.

  8. Lumen on Ninth
    3.4(5 reviews)FMP Score

    why it ranked: Lumen on Ninth has a leasing team that genuinely cares about making a good first impression, with specialists like Rhianna earning consistent praise for their warmth and professionalism. The space itself is nice and the location is solid for students near campus. However, maintenance responsiveness is a real concern residents report unresolved issues like refrigerator problems and lingering odor problems that don't get fixed despite multiple requests. As one resident put it, "Do not rent from this place, especially if you think maintenance is going to fix anything." The follow-through after move-in doesn't match the enthusiasm during leasing.

  11. Uncommon Columbus
    1.2(5 reviews)FMP Score

    why it ranked: Uncommon Columbus's ranking reflects the gap between its appealing location near Short North and the serious habitability issues that have frustrated residents. Students report ongoing pest infestations that management has failed to resolve despite repeated reports, along with unexpected fees and maintenance problems that undermine confidence in the property's operations. As one resident put it, "There are rats and mice in the WALLS! We reported in February, and all they do is put traps down!" When basic cleanliness and safety aren't guaranteed, proximity to the neighborhood can only carry a property so far.

FMP award criteria

How We Ranked These Apartments

1

Ranked by the FMP Score

FMP Score, high to low. That’s the whole ranking. It’s our overall measure of a property, combining verified review scores with signals reviews miss, like how current the listing is kept and how responsive management is. Ties go to the property with more verified reviews.

2

Who Makes the List

Every property near OSU can appear, but it takes a minimum number of verified reviews before we score and rank it. Properties under that bar sit below every ranked property and move up automatically as reviews come in.

3

How We Calculate the FMP Score

The FMP Score blends the social, management, and quality scores from verified reviews with signals that a place is actively and well run, like how up to date its listing is kept and how consistently management responds to residents. It’s built to surface genuinely well-run properties, not just the highest raw review average.

How is this ranking calculated?

This list is ranked by one number: each property's overall score from verified reviews. Students rate a property's overall 1 to 5, and we average those scores, counting recent reviews more heavily than older ones. No self-reported data from landlords.

What makes an apartment the best overall?

The best overall apartments score highly across everything students rate (social scene, management, and unit quality), not just one. This ranking uses each property's overall rating from verified reviews.

How often is this ranking updated?

Monthly. We re-pull verified reviews and re-score every property at the start of each month, so the order reflects the most recent 24 months of student feedback. The “updated” date at the top of the page shows the latest refresh.

How many reviews does a property need to be included?

There's a minimum number of verified reviews to rank by score, and we don't publish the exact bar so it can't be gamed. Properties under it still appear, below every qualified property and ordered by review count, so a 5.0 from one review never outranks a 4.5 from thirty. Once a property collects enough reviews, it moves into the scored ranking automatically.
